Scheunemann is a surname of North German origin. It is derived from the Middle Low German words schüne (barn) and mann (man), "barn man". It is either a toponymic for people who lived near tithe-barns or an occupational surname for officers who collected agricultural tithes.[1] Notable people with the surname include:
